1923 Bentley 3 Litre
Chassis No. 193
Engine No. 202
Registration No. (Not available)
 
Click on thumbnail for larger view
 
 
 

Chassis No: 193 - Blue Label 10'10" wheelbase with a rather unattractive tourer body. It was a hairy thing to drive and required considerable work to bring it up to a desirable standard. As I also had the 4½-litre which was in such good order that I sold the 3 Litre to an enthusiast here in Melbourne and I have not seen it again in over forty years.

 
     
     
  Source: Ron Bone

EARLIEST RECORD OF HISTORICAL FACTS & INFORMATION
 
Chassis No. 193
Engine No. 202
Registration No. (Not available)
Date of Delivery: Mar 1923
Type of Body: Saloon
Coachbuilder: No info
Type of Car: L
   
First Owner: C.D.R. Pritchett
 
     
  More Info: Michael Hay, in his book Bentley: The Vintage Years, 1997, states: "In Australia. Engine made up of 202 and 594 ex ch. 581. Fitted 4 seat body."
